So i like to have them just below the workbench, instead of in a drawer. So i recently built these two screw cases to store the screws in plastic Tupperware. I like the fact that these are small, modular, the screws are visible, and can be moved anywhere in the shop. The shelves themselves were not difficult to make and didn't cost anything. I used solid pine for the sides and cut the slots with the radial arm saw. The top, bottom and back were thin plywood, and the shelves were cheap hardboard.
